The Ridgemont Golden Gophers's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Saturday after their third straight loss. They took a 43-32 hit to the loss column at the hands of Ridgedale. Ridgemont has struggled against Ridgedale recently, as their game on Saturday was their sixth consecutive lost matchup.
Ridgemont lost despite a true team effort on the offense, the best among them being Anna Ramsey, who scored 14 points along with four steals. Ruth Eckstein was another key contributor, scoring four points along with 13 rebounds and five steals.
Ridgemont's defeat dropped their record down to 1-12. As for Ridgedale, the victory (which was their third in a row) raised their record to 8-6.
